How to Generate Leads Online

No Comments »

Generating leads online will take some effort and time on your part. Getting on Google’s first search page takes time, this does not happen for people over night. To help you get started here are 6 ways to boost your lead generation results. You may find one or two that interest you or you may find all of them do. This is a personal preference for some.

Website - This is one of the most important ways to generate leads online. Once you have your website fully operational you will want to run a program along with your website that will help you keep track of your leads. This is a very important tool to have.

Twitter - This is one of the fastest growing social networks right now. You can use twitter or any other social network that appeals to you. You might find it useful to set up an account on a few different platforms. This will help reach out to even more clientele. Most social networks are free to users and very simple to get started.

Blogging - This is a great way to put your name out in the open. This will allow you to inform people about what you are selling. You will not want to make this a high profile pitch. Start by giving accurate information about what you are selling. Wordpress.com and blogger.com are free services to get you started. You can get started in as simple as 3 steps.

Ezines - This is a great way to get you published. Each Ezine (Electronic Magazines) will have different rules and information about what they will and will not allow. Always make sure to read their instruction page and respect their rules. Otherwise you might get marked as a spammer. This can be a very powerful way to inform potential consumers. Make sure to give plenty of solid information about your product. Do not be overly pitchy in your articles.

Regular Content - It is not enough to have a few articles and accounts set up. Your name can quickly go to the end of the line, if you don’t keep updating your information. Make sure to constantly update your blog, add new articles, and update the accounts you have for your company. This will help keep your name and information out to potential consumers.

Pay Per Click - This is another way to generate leads. There are a few options to choose from when using pay per clicks. You will have to spend money on PPC, but you can control how much you spend. With some vendors, like Google, you can limit your expenses to a dollar a day or less. This keeps the budget manageable.

All 6 of these ideas will help you get your name out there faster. The more people see your name the more people will become interested in your product. Make sure all of your articles, blogs, and anything else you publish conveys the same message. You want everything to flow with all of your messages. Be patient and stay consistent, by updating all of your information and your numbers are sure to grow.

Make Online Income From Google Adsense

No Comments »

Do you want to earn money online by doing practically nothing? If you do, Google Adsense is your answer. Google Adsense is a way to earn money by placing ads on your websites. It is one of the most popular ways to generate income using the web these days.

If you’ve heard of the term passive income, it perfectly defines the earning opportunities from the Google Adsense program. This means that you can earn from the program with little or no work. This may sound dubious, but it actually works. All you need to do is to get on with the initial work and watch as your income increases.

If you want to know how Google Adsense actually works, take a look at how someone who owns a commercial building starts rolling in income. The first thing that he needs to do is to buy a building. Next, he has to hire employees to manage the building and work on its upkeep. After that, he can rent the building out to people. After accomplishing this groundwork, he will do nothing more than to receive money from his investment. Google Adsense works in a similar way.

With Google Adsense, you will lay your groundwork by creating websites. Once you have your websites, you can start placing ads on them. The ads posted will be relevant to the content of your pages. A site about dogs, for example, will have ads on pet shops, dog food, toys for pets, and many other pet-related products or services. Google makes sure that your ads are related to the content of your website. You will earn if visitors click on these ads.

You do not have to worry about finding the right ads for your website because Google will do that for you. Even if your website is not about anything specific, Google will still find ads that will be relevant to your content. The fact is Google have ads for many kinds of businesses in all kinds of industries. So there will be no shortage of relevant ads for your site.

Companies that advertise on Google can be based on other countries. There may also be advertisers from your area. These businesses can choose to post ads only on websites that are in countries or areas that they specify. These ads can also be displayed in other languages in order to reel in more customers.

After understanding the basics of Adsense, you need to create an account. Visit the website of Google Adsense and type in your information on their application form. After your application has been approved, you will be able to post the ad codes on your web pages. It’s that easy.

But before creating an account, make sure that you read the terms and conditions that govern the program. There is also an FAQ section that will be very helpful for you. Reading these is important because if you are not aware of certain rules, your account might get suspended.

But if you already know the policies, you can start enjoying your Adsense passive income. Create your ads and paste the code provided on your web pages. The ads will appear after a few minutes and you are on your way to making money.

Email Newsletter Open Rates and Email Campaign Software

No Comments »

Do you know the best day of the week and time to do your business email marketing and send your email newsletter? Have you ever wondered if your fellow newsletter marketers are all sending at the same time you do? Convinced your open rate is too low or even too high?

Some recent statistics may help you answer these questions: What Kind of Open Rates Are Email Marketers Getting and what kind of email campaign software are they using. If you are sending HTML emails, you probably use your open rate to help gauge your success. Even though its not a perfect measure of whether people are actually opening and reading your emails, its useful as a relative measure: If it goes up over a short period of time, more people are probably reading If it falls over a short period of time, its almost certain fewer people are reading.

Also, all other things being the same, it can give you some motivation or satisfaction. So, here goes Average Open Rate this past Month: 13.6% So when is the best day to send?

You will often hear that Tuesday is the best day to send, because on Monday people are busy from the weekend, and that on Tuesday morning you will have their undivided attention before they start into their work for the upcoming week. Do the numbers back up that?

The rate of opens by day of the week: Monday 13.78% Tuesday 13.32% Wednesday 14.18% Thursday 14.61% Friday 13.36% Saturday 12.18% Sunday 13.46%. Just last month, Tuesday was the second worst day to send. I should point out this, too, the hour of the day that got the best open rate was not 9-10AM or during the morning at all, but in fact 2-3PM Eastern Time ” email newsletters sent during that hour last month enjoyed a 19.3% open rate. Does This mean I should switch my campaigns to Thursdays?

Simple answer, no. if you already are sending to a contact list. Do not break with your readers expectations just to try to follow the latest day of the week stats. You might actually reduce your open rate. In both March and February, Thursday newsletters got the 3rd-worst opens vs. the rest of that week.

I hesitated a little to release these stats, because I’m concerned that people may start sending their newsletters at the day or time that happened to get the best results lately. Please, do not drastically change your sending schedule just because you see that the average last month, happened to be higher on a different day or time. Yes, you might eventually be able to shift your sending schedule, or split test some broadcasts, but if you up and move everything, you may throw off your subscribers who are used to hearing from you at the usual time.

To get at the other reason for not changing your sending based on these stats. If everyone switches their sending schedule to send on say, Thursday, then recipients will start getting a ton of email that day, and start paying less attention to each individual email and you still have a lower conversion. One possible reason for Thursdays success last month may be that it wasnt as popular as say, Tuesday or Wednesday for sending email: Percentage of Newsletters Sent by Day Monday 16.1% Tuesday 17.8% Wednesday 16.8% Thursday 16.7% Friday 15.3% Saturday 8.9% Sunday 8.9%

Those higher-volume days mean more emails in readers in boxes, which might contribute to reducing open rates. Following that reasoning, some people may look at the low weekend volume and see an opportunity to get their audiences undivided attention.

The main point in showing these stats is to point out that our assumptions about what works are often quite wrong, and that you ultimately have to test for yourself to see what best suits your recipients. Here is some inspiration and some help. Are you getting better open rates than this? Give yourself a pat on the back my friend, but do not get complacent. Open rates are not the be all, end all of email metrics and business email marketing can play a roll in actual conversions. They do not guarantee that people are reading your business email campaigns, only that they have images turned on and that they probably saw your email for at least a moment.

Some ideas that can help you raise your open rates: Ask people to add you to their address books. Some email newsletter software will display images from senders who are in the recipients contact list. If you are putting pictures in your emails, use the ALT text for those images to pique readers interest in what the picture is, so that they enable images. Or directly ask readers to turn on images! Add a picture of yourself to your emails, near/next to your signature. People like seeing your smiling face, and if they see it in one of your emails, they may be more likely to turn on images to see it again later.

Advertising Cost involved in Pay Per Click Marketing

No Comments »

Pay per click marketing (PPC) is an effective online marketing tool, but aside from that, it has also provided many website owners the opportunity to make money on the internet. Indeed, PPC has been a good avenue for website owners to earn from their sites.

Pay per click marketing emerged in 2002 and since its introduction, it has become a popular tool for businesses to advertise their products online. Google also adopted the concept in their popular Google Adwords tool.

This marketing tool allows you to post your ads on as many websites in the internet, by making an agreement with the website owners. There will be no cost involved in the posting of the ad or text links but once online users get interested and click on your ads, you have to pay the website owner of the agreed cost per click.

The pay per click concept follows two models of determining the cost. The flat rate model and the bid based model.

In the flat rate pay per click marketing, you can negotiate with the website owner a fix rate or cost of each click to your ad posted in his website. This usually depends on the web page and the relevance of the website to your business. You can also keep a rate card, which lists all the rates for your ads in different web pages or websites.

On the bid-based pay per click marketing, the cost per click of your advertisement is determined through bidding with other companies and advertisers. The rate then is based on how much you are willing to pay for every click of your ad for a particular ad spot. In this method of pay per click marketing, you will be competing with other advertisers as to the lowest cost you can pay for every click for your ad.

In adopting pay per click marketing however, it is important to define your goals and make sure you avoid the common pitfalls of this advertising technique. It is also important to keep in mind that getting the right people to click your ads is very important in achieving your end goals in advertising.
